Caesars Entertainment
Maintenance Technicial (Eldorado Scioto Downs - Columbus, OH)
Caesars Entertainment, Columbus, Ohio, United States, 43224
Columbus, OH, United States (On-site)
Job Description 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
Performs preventive maintenance tasks.
Completes and maintains preventive maintenance reports.
Assists maintenance technicians in completion of tasks and to learned techniques methods and procedures.
Other duties may be assigned.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S & ABILITIES
High school diploma or GED equivalent preferred.
One year minimum experience preferred in the following areas: plumbing, sweat copper, installation and repair of plumbing fixtures, electrical components, and blue print reading.
Ability to obtain and maintain a valid state gaming license.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S & WORK ENVIRONMENTS
Frequent standing, walking, use hands to handle, or feel; and reach with hands and arms.
Able to sit; climb or balance; and st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l.
Able to l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.
The team member is occ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ions; moving mechanical parts; high places, fumes or airborne particles, outside weather conditions, variable indoor temperatures, smoke, lighting and noise levels.
